We test cooling bedding in controlled room conditions and real-home use. The controlled block captures temperature drop, humidity transfer, and recovery speed. The home block checks comfort, noise, drape, and durability after repeated wash cycles.
Every product is logged against consistent criteria: contact-cooling feel, sustained cooling over 6 hours, moisture management, airflow, wash behavior, and value for price.
